What to Expect During Your Facelift

The surgery may take two to four hours, based on the complexity.

When you arrive, you’ll first be taken into a preoperative room. Here, you’ll receive an IV, and you’ll also be sedated. You’ll also be given an antibiotic to reduce the risk of infection.

As soon as you’re sedated your surgeon will start by making an initial incision near your hairline. After separating the skin from the tissue beneath, the surgeon will lift and tighten underlying muscles.

Then, the extra skin will be removed and the remaining skin will be sutured back together. Lastly, the surgeon will apply dressings or bandages at the incision sites.

You will then be taken to an aftercare room, where rest and recovery is provided until you are ready to return home.

What is facelift surgery?

A facelift surgery, also known as rhytidectomy, is a cosmetic procedure that helps rejuvenate the face by removing excess facial skin, tightening underlying muscles, and repositioning tissues. It can treat sagging, deep folds and jowls as well as other signs of ageing in the neck and face area.

Can a facelift surgery correct droopy eyelids or forehead wrinkles?

Facelifts focus on the lower and neck regions. While it can provide some rejuvenation to the midface, it does not specifically target droopy eyelids or forehead wrinkles. For these concerns, additional procedures such as eyelid surgery (blepharoplasty) or a brow lift may be recommended.

Will a facelift completely remove my wrinkles?

Facelift surgery may reduce the appearance of wrinkles but may not eliminate them. Facelift surgery primarily targets excess skin and tissue laxity. Fine lines and wrinkles, however, may require additional treatments such as laser resurfacing and injectables in order to achieve optimal results.
